Cicciari Resigns at Granada Hills
- Share via
Lou Cicciari, who has coached basketball for 20 years at Granada Hills High despite being confined to a wheelchair, announced his resignation for health reasons.
Cicciari, 41, has been the boys’ basketball coach for eight years and was considered a coaching trendsetter for the handicapped. His legs were amputated at age 7.
He will continue to teach at Granada Hills.
